Field Station Moab

Field Station Moab is a 3-star hotel in Moab, Utah, United States. Address: 889 North Main Street. It sits 1.1mi from the city center, a handy base for exploring the area. The property has 458 reviews.

Amenities include a pet-friendly policy with extra charges, an on-site restaurant and bar, and a free outdoor swimming pool. Free private parking and free WiFi help keep stays easy, while air conditioning and non-smoking rooms add comfort. Other perks include a sun deck, 24-hour front desk, live music/performances, wheelchair accessibility, and beach umbrellas and chairs provided free along with free toiletries.

Rates start from $88 per night.

Wow, we were overwhelmed with how great Field Station was. It was super clean, the beds extremely comfy and the rooms were always comfortable temperatures. The fire pit and hot tub were fantastic. It was a little chilly for us to use the pool, but I can also the say the staff were incredibly knowledgeable about activities to do around Moab. I thought the location was fantastic, as we were going between Arches, Canyonlands, and Moab. If you want to be right in the heart of Moab, it's a 15-20 minute walk, but we also liked being a little away from everything too.

I love that the hotel has bike racks for the room, although I did not bring my bike on this trip nice to know they exist. Room was spacious clean except it was missing a coffee machine and/or microwave. Beds were very comfortable. I didn’t understand why there is a long wooden bench in the room but whatever. It was good for all of our luggages. One down fall was no elevators. It’s been a long time since I’ve been to a hotel w/o elevators which I find it very odd. I love that the hotel has a bike store, coffee shop and amenities such as ping pong table, pool, jacuzzi and board games great for the kids. The location could have been a little closer to all the main restaurants/bar but it wasn’t that far to drive to them either. Overall I’d stay here again.

Frequently Asked Questions - Field Station Moab

Does Field Station Moab allow guests to stay with pets?

Yes, you can stay with your pet at Field Station Moab. Please note that there may be charges for bringing your pet.

What's the check-in and check-out schedule at Field Station Moab?

Guests at Field Station Moab can check in starting from 04:00 PM and need to check out by 10:00 AM.

Does Field Station Moab come with parking?

Yes, there is convenient and private parking available for all guests at the Field Station Moab. Not only is it on site, but it is also free of charge. Please note that parking reservation is required, ensuring that all guests have a designated space during their stay.

What are the rates at Field Station Moab?

Rates at Field Station Moab commence from $88. However, final pricing may depend on room choices and booking dates. Always input your stay dates for precise rates.
